Nurse X wants to use a very detailed decision-making tool to show the amount of time required to complete a project from beginning to end. Which tool should she use?
 
  a. Delphi diagram c. Gantt chart
  b. PERT diagram flowchart d. Decision analysis tree

Answer to Question 1

C
A Gantt chart is used in decision making when a project is needed to be clearly defined from beginning to end; hence it would be a good tool for Nurse X to use to outline her project. The Delphi technique (not diagram) is a kind of group decision making.
The program evaluation and review technique (PERT) provides a visual picture of required tasks over an amount of time, but is not as detailed as the Gantt chart. The decision analysis tree is another good tool for decision making but is not as detailed as the Gantt chart and may or may not include a timeline for completion of tasks.

Answer to Question 2

C
In the nominal technique for group decision making, the members are meeting in a face-to-face environment. Some key advantages of the Delphi technique is that it is not held in a face-to-face environment and it can involve a large number of participants, therefore sharing a greater number of ideas.
